Abstract

The invention discloses a temperature control and humidity control fresh-keeping cabinet. The temperature control and humidity control fresh-keeping cabinet comprises a cuboid cabinet body and a cabinet door fixed to the front side of the cabinet body. A first partition plate and a second partition plate which are parallel are arranged in the cabinet body from top to bottom in a spaced mode. The cabinet body is divided into a first fresh-keeping chamber, a second fresh-keeping chamber and a temperature and humidity adjusting chamber from top to bottom through the first partition plate and the second partition plate. Fans and figured glass boxes are installed in the first fresh-keeping chamber and the second fresh-keeping chamber. A controller is electrically connected with temperature and humidity sensors, the fans, a temperature adjusting device, an ozone generator and a vacuum pump. According to the temperature control and humidity control fresh-keeping cabinet, the temperature and the humidity in the cabinet can be timely monitored and adjusted; and in addition, peculiar smells in the fresh-keeping cabinet can be removed through ozone and vacuumizing, the activity of enzymes is inhibited, mildewing and deterioration of fruits and vegetables are prevented, and the fresh-keeping period is prolonged by 2-3 times.

technical field [0001] The invention relates to the field of fresh-keeping equipment, in particular to a temperature-controlled and humidity-controlled fresh-keeping cabinet for storing different kinds of fruits, vegetables or food. Background technique [0002] Along with the raising of people's living standard, electric refrigerator is very popular. It is mainly equipped with a freezer and a cold room. People mainly use the freezer to store food that needs to be stored for a long time, such as meat and fish, while the cold room is suitable for storing fresh food such as fruits and vegetables. Recently, people's pace of life is accelerating, more and more people go shopping on weekends, the requirements for the shelf life of food are getting higher and higher, and the demand for the fresh-keeping function of refrigerators is becoming stronger and stronger.
